Solution Overview
Problem
Mobile network operators face challenges in recouping subsidies for user equipment (UE) as many devices are purchased without activating the SIM card, allowing users to connect to Wi-Fi and download VoIP applications or unlock the device, leading to unpaid services and the sale of unlocked devices on the black market.
Innovation Solution
Implementing a user equipment (UE) that disables Wi-Fi access if the SIM card is not activated, presenting the user with a graphical user interface (GUI) indicating that Wi-Fi access is disabled until the SIM card is activated, thereby requiring users to purchase and activate the SIM card before using the device's mobile services.

Data Source
AI summary
Example embodiments relate to a user equipment that can receive a command to turn on the user equipment. In response to determining that the user equipment has not been initialized, and prior to displaying a graphical user interface listing a Wi-Fi network to which the user equipment can connect, the user equipment presents a graphical user interface that displays an option to activate a cellular service provided by a mobile network operator entity, but does not display an option to activate the cellular service at a subsequent time.
